Abstract

Pak choy is a vegetable that content high nutrition, beneficial for health, and the price is higher compared to other types of mustard greens, so that pak choy cultivation has bright prospects. One effort to get quality pak choy is by providing chicken manure liquid organic fertilizer (LOF). The research was conducted to study: the interaction; concentration of LOF; and time interval for applying LOF that provides the best growth and yield of pak choy. The experiment was conducted from June to August 2021 in Sumber Sari Village, Sebulu District, Kutai Kartanegara Regency, East Kalimantan Province. The experiment was arranged in a Split Plot Design with six replications. The concentration of LOF as the Main Plot, consisting of four levels, namely control (0), 25, 50, 75 mL L-1; and time interval for applying LOF as Subplots, consisted of every 2 and 4 days. Data were analyzed using analysis of variance, continued with Duncan's Multiple Range Test at 5% level. The relationship between plant dry weight and LOF concentration was determined using polynomial orthogonal regression and correlation analysis. The results showed that the interaction and the time interval for applying LOF was not significantly different on all variables; while the efffect of LOF concentration is significantly different on all variables. A concentration of 25 mL POC L-1 is able to meet the nutritional needs of pak choy. The shape and strength of the relationship between dry weight of pak choy and POC concentration is linear and very strong with the regression equation ŷ = 3.263 + 0.0615x; correlation coefficient (r) 0.8344; and the coefficient of determination (R2) is 0.6963.
